What It Means
Of Norse origin, meaning 'beautiful victory'. It's also a common name in Scandinavian countries.

Astrid
Norse
Meaning
Astrid is a name of Norse origin, meaning "divinely beautiful" or "divinely loved," combining the elements *áss* meaning "god" and *fríðr* meaning "beautiful, fair".
